Output 8a269cac0c86d6badb3c904cd128b2ba9a627530eb6760b888649a32570b9c11:4

value
2895638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 485b4d844d1cd1f183685e64c9b6d704f032bf17 OP_EQUAL
address
38HbxBhcYsgFoqN96nRFXsQJ1QUZX47hn5
transaction
8a269cac0c86d6badb3c904cd128b2ba9a627530eb6760b888649a32570b9c11
spent
true